Acta Cryst. (2006). E62, o866-o868 [ doi:10.1107/S160053680600314X ]
Abstract: In the structure of the title compound, C21H17NO2, the four-membered
-lactam ring is nearly planar, with long C-C distances of 1.526 (3) and 1.567 (3) Å. The angles between the planes of the three phenyl rings and this group are 81.12 (8), 3.02 (8) and 49.88 (7)°. The dihedral angles between the planes of the phenyl rings are 83.72 (7), 68.03 (7) and 47.06 (6)°. The crystal structure is stabilized by inter- and intramolecular C-H
O hydrogen-bond interactions.
